Forex trading has evolved beyond manual execution, becoming a high-tech financial trend globally. The Exness API acts as a powerful bridge, allowing you to connect, automate, and manage trading activities seamlessly from anywhere. But what exactly does this feature entail, and how can you utilize it effectively? Please refer to the following article by EX Trading to gain a deep understanding of this specialized service!
Main content
ToggleComprehensive Guide to Exness API
To master the Exness API in foreign exchange trading, you first need to grasp the fundamental concept of an API. Whether you are a trader looking to automate strategies or a partner looking to manage client data, understanding the Exness Partnership API and Trading API is crucial for maximizing your efficiency in the Forex market.
The content below details the service functions, usage instructions, and common error codes to help you avoid technical pitfalls.
1. What is an API?
API stands for Application Programming Interface. Simply put, an API is a software intermediary that allows two different applications to “talk” to each other using a common programming language. It acts as a messenger that delivers your request to the provider and then delivers the response back to you.
APIs are the backbone of modern software connectivity, used in web-based systems, operating systems, and database management. In the financial world, APIs are widely adopted by major exchanges, including Exness, to facilitate real-time data exchange and automated execution.
For new investors, using an API might seem complex. It is recommended to find reputable brokers or join community groups on Facebook or Zalo to learn the basics before integration.
2. What is the Exness API?
The Exness API is a set of protocols that allows developers and traders to interact directly with the Exness servers without logging into the standard website interface. It essentially gives you programmatic access to the features found in the Personal Area.
- For Partners: The API allows you to create custom websites, aggregate data, track client performance, and manage campaigns dynamically.
- For Traders: While this article focuses on the Partner API, Exness also provides APIs for trading terminals to automate buy/sell orders.

3. Benefits of Using the Exness API
Integrating the API brings immense scalability and convenience, especially for those working within the Exness referral program (IB Exness). It automates mundane tasks, allowing you to focus on strategy and growth.
Key advantages include:
- Security Protocols: Supports setting specific standards and security privileges for data access.
- Automated Payouts: Helps regulate and implement commission payments (rebates) to sub-IBs or clients automatically.
- Campaign Management: Create, track, and manage specific advertising campaigns with real-time data.
- Reporting: Build a custom database to generate detailed partnership reports and analytics.
- Promotions Access: Direct programmatic access to the latest Exness promotions and banners.
4. Who Can Use the API on Exness?
Primarily, the Exness API is designed for Partners (IBs) and Professional Traders. For partners, it facilitates the seamless extraction of Personal Area (PA) data to build custom dashboards or integrate with third-party CRM systems.
For example, a partner can collaborate with a web developer to build a site that aggregates live spreads, commission stats, and client registrations from Exness servers without manually checking the Exness dashboard.

See more: Create Exness Account: Instructions for on your phone
How to Set Up and Use Exness API Services
To start using the API, you must have a registered Exness account with Partner privileges. You can register via Exness.com.
Step-by-Step Guide to API Authorization:
Step 1: Access the My Exness affiliate dashboard documentation to use the /API/auth authorization method.
Step 2: Enter the registered Email and Password associated with your Partner's Personal Area.
Step 3: Select the “Try It Out” button. Upon successful execution, the system will generate an Authorization Token in the Response Body section.

Note: Accurate data entry is crucial here to ensure the token is generated correctly.
Step 4: Copy the generated token. Click on the “Authorize” button (usually a lock icon). Enter the value in the format: JWT TOKEN_VALUE and click Authorize. You can now test endpoints like /API/partner/summary/ to confirm connectivity.

Common Exness API Error Codes
During integration, you may encounter HTTP response errors. Understanding these codes will help you debug faster. Below is a reference table:
| Error Name | Status Code | Meaning & Solution |
| Parse / Validation Error | 400 | Bad Request. The server cannot process the request due to malformed syntax. Check your input data. |
| Authentication Failed / Token Expired | 401 | Unauthorized. Your API token is missing, invalid, or expired. Generate a new token. |
| Permission Denied | 403 | Forbidden. You do not have the necessary permissions to access this resource. |
| Not Found | 404 | The requested resource or endpoint URL does not exist. |
| Method Not Allowed | 405 | Using GET instead of POST (or vice versa). Check the documentation. |
| Throttled | 429 | Too Many Requests. You have exceeded the rate limit. Slow down your request frequency. |
Why Choose Exness for Investment?
Exness is recognized as a leading broker in the Forex market, providing a robust infrastructure for API trading and partnerships. Investors trust Exness due to its licensing by top-tier organizations like the FCA, CySEC, FSA, and FSCA.
Currently, Exness supports advanced platforms like MT4 and MT5, offering a diverse range of trading instruments. A standout feature is the Instant Withdrawal system, which operates 24/7, including weekends, ensuring you always have access to your funds.
With over a decade of operation, Exness has won numerous prestigious awards, including Best Trade Execution and Best Client Support.
See more: The most detailed overview of the Broker Exness
Top Reasons to Trade with Exness:
- Flexible Payments: Multiple deposit and withdrawal methods with $0 fees.
- Security: Member of the Financial Commission with a compensation fund of up to €20,000 per client.
- Diverse Portfolio: Trade Forex, Crypto, Energies, Stocks, and Indices.
- Transparency: Audited by Deloitte; trading volume and financial reports are public.
- Technology: Access to MT4, MT5, WebTerminal, and the proprietary Exness Terminal.
- Account Variety: From Standard accounts for beginners to Zero/Raw Spread accounts for pros.
- Global Support: 24/7 customer service in 15+ languages.
Conclusion
Through this guide, you should now have a clear understanding of the Exness API and how to deploy it for your partnership or trading needs. Hopefully, the information provided by EX Trading will assist you in automating your workflow and achieving success in the global foreign exchange market. If you encounter any technical difficulties during integration, do not hesitate to contact the Exness support team for timely assistance.
FAQ
Is the Exness API free to use?
Yes, Exness provides API access completely free of charge for its partners and clients. There are no setup fees or monthly subscription costs involved in generating tokens or making requests.
Can I use the Exness API for automated trading?
Absolutely. While the Partner API is used for managing client data and campaigns, Exness also supports trading APIs (compatible with MT4/MT5) that allow you to connect algorithmic trading bots directly to the Exness servers for faster execution.
What should I do if I get an “Authentication Failed” error?
This error (Status 401) typically means your API Token has expired or was copied incorrectly. To fix it, log in to your Personal Area, generate a new Authorization Token, and update it in your application's request header.



